Mesothelioma Compensation

Asbestos sufferers can be compensated from the asbestos trust fund as well as legal settlements. A top mesothelioma attorney can examine the work history of a person and determine where asbestos exposure occurred.

Mesothelioma compensation can help pay for medical expenses, lost income, and more. A lawyer can guide a family through the claims process.

1. Medical expenses

The diagnosis of mesothelioma could be traumatic for patients and their loved ones. Families are required to alter their lives rapidly and concentrate on treatment options, often placing other priorities aside for a time. These changes can be expensive, especially as mesothelioma can be a fatal illness with no cure. Compensation for mesothelioma could aid families in addressing medical expenses and other financial issues relating to asbestos exposure.

Mesothelioma patients and their families may want to consider bringing a lawsuit for compensation against the companies who exposed them to asbestos. This will cover their expenses and other losses. Compensation can come from multiple sources such as trust funds, mesothelioma-related settlements or verdicts. Some of these expenses can be covered by government or insurance programs, such as Medicare and Medicaid. Individuals who been in the military or are diagnosed with mesothelioma may apply for benefits for veterans to help offset cancer-related expenses.

Clinical research trials have also been a life-changing treatment for many mesothelioma sufferers. However these trials are considered to be experimental and oftentimes will not be covered by traditional insurance.

A mesothelioma case can compensate patients for all medical costs. This could include regular follow-up care and tests. Compensation can also be used to cover other losses, such as funeral costs and lost income from a mesothelioma-related disability.

2. Suffering and pain

If you're diagnosed with Mesothelioma, it can be extremely painful and difficult to endure. The disease can cause a variety of pains, including breathing problems and discomfort during every day activities. It is also possible to lose income because of the disease since you'll need to dedicate more time and energy to your treatment. This can result in struggling to pay your living expenses. You may also become stressed and indebted which can lead to depression.

The emotional and physical pain mesothelioma patients suffer should be compensated. However, determining the amount the damages are worth is difficult. This is due to mesothelioma being an individual experience that affects every victim in a different way. Certain cases result in million-dollar settlements, while other cases settle for a much lower amount. Many factors can affect the value of a mesothelioma case, such as how severe the patient's symptoms are, how long they've suffered, and how the disease has affected their quality of life.

Although there is no cure for mesothelioma there is there are numerous options to aid those suffering from the disease. There are surgeries to eliminate lung tissues and fluid, chemotherapy treatments to reduce cancerous tumors and immunotherapies that increase the effectiveness of treatment. These treatments can be costly and may not be effective. They can also be very uncomfortable and injurious.

4. Damages for emotional distress

A patient with mesothelioma typically experiences a wide variety of symptoms, including anxiety, fear, depression and a sense of losing control over their health. These symptoms can cause emotional trauma and anxiety which can negatively impact the quality of life for a person. As part of the damages for pain and suffering an individual plaintiff may be awarded compensation for these issues. The amount of compensation awarded will depend on how severe the patient's symptoms are and the severity of their symptoms.

Emotional distress damages are a kind of non-economic damages. These damages are rarer than those for pain and suffering, and they can be more difficult to prove. This kind of compensation is typically awarded by a jury or judge in instances where the victim suffered serious injuries which have an impact on their mental health.

For instance, people with mesothelioma can experience emotional distress if they are unable to find treatments that are suitable to their particular needs. This could include the inability to manage a household, work or participate in other activities they used to engage in regularly. Patients with mesothelioma will also experience an abundance of stress because of the ongoing nature of their illness.

In addition, if a mesothelioma victim is witness to the death of a loved one because of the actions of a third party, they might be eligible for financial compensation through a wrongful death lawsuit. This type of claim is filed by a family member or the estate of a deceased victim and seeks to recover compensation for a variety of economic and non-economic loss.
